Roth IRA A Roth IRA is comparable in goal to other IRAs, however it is funded working with right after-tax cash. Investments are permitted to mature tax-free of charge. There is not any tax on withdrawals, possibly, should you stick to particular regulations, such as being no less than 59½ yrs old and obtaining this or One more Roth IRA for a minimum of five years. The younger that you are, or even the decreased your tax bracket, the greater you may take pleasure in owning a Roth IRA.

Self-Directed IRAs adhere to straightforward IRA rules concerning contributions and withdrawals. our website The tax advantages of investing by way of a Self-Directed IRA count on whether it is a traditional, pretax program or Roth IRA. The once-a-year contribution limit for IRAs in both of those 2024 and 2025 is $seven,000, permitting individuals to invest this amount within their retirement accounts.
